Hartlepool United will look to kick on from Saturdays winning opener as they travel to Chesterfield.
Pools will head to the Proact Stadium for a 7.45pm kick off having played one game extra to their opponents as Chesterfields opening tie at Wealdstone was postponed due to a waterlogged pitch.
Pools picked up a memorable result last season as they came away 5-1 winners and Dave Challinor will look for a repeat to make it two consecutive wins.
There are no injury concerns for Pools. David Parkhouse will miss out due to being on international duty for Northern Ireland U21s.
